A man covers 1/3 of his journey by bus at 30 km/h, 1/3 by train at 60 km/h and the last 1/3 by scooter at 20 km/h. Find his average speed for the whole journey.
Explanation:
Let each third of the journey be 60 km. Total distance = 3 * 60 = 180 km. Total time taken = 60/30 + 60/60 + 60/20 = 2 + 1 + 3 = 6 hours. Average speed = 180 / 6 = 30 km/h.
